2026 New Jersey Academic Libraries Conference

  • Leadership, Partnership, Empowerment: Libraries Advancing Success in Higher Education
  • Friday, January 9, 2026 at Liberty Hall Academic Center, Kean, University, Union, NJ

The New Jersey Academic Libraries Conference is a full day of sessions held annually in early January, this conference brings together academic librarians from across New Jersey to explore emerging trends, technologies, and challenges shaping the field. Whether you are an experienced professional or new to the profession, the event offers a valuable opportunity to connect with colleagues, exchange ideas, and engage in meaningful professional development.

The conference is free of charge for NJAL members and for librarians, faculty, and staff from VALE member institutions.
